know there is an upgrade_export script.  But it requires user input
(saying yes), so I'm not sure how I could script/cron that?  Anyone
know what files to tar/zip, or how to make upgrade_export cron-able?

Write an Expect script. It's a bit dated, but it will do the job. O'Reilly has a decent reference: http://www.oreilly.com/catalog/expect/index.html
